"Sayasat" is a word in HILIGAYNON

sayasat HILIGAYNON
Definition:

sayásat - To comprehend, understand,
know, grasp. Walâ siá makasayásat sang
ginsilíng ko sa íya. He could not
understand what I said to him. (cf. sáyod,
sát-um, hibaló, etc.),
sayási, To comprehend, understand,
know. Ang dílì ko masayási amó——. What
I cannot understand is——. (cf. sayásat).
